Ahead of Ethan Embry’s appearance in the upcoming legacy sequel Scream 7, he’s taking on a totally different kind of killer from Ghostface. FANGORIA is excited to present an exclusive clip from Republic Pictures’ new psychological thriller Alma & the Wolf, which hits digital this month and pits Embry against something much more supernatural than a man in a mask.
Alma & the Wolf stars Sinners’ Li Jun Li alongside Empire Records star Embry, and follows the former as Deputy Ren Accord, a small-town sheriff whose son vanishes in the woods just outside town. As the search for the young boy mounts, paranoia takes root and reality begins to fracture as things go awry far quicker than anyone can handle.
Our exclusive clip features Embry alongside co-star Kevin Allison as Officer Stanton, both panicking as they’re backed into a corner, a paranormal monster on the other side of a locked door. While Stanton is sure he’s not going to make it out, he urges Ren to escape via the building’s air ducts, offering cover as he finally loses the last of his sanity.
Directed by Michael Patrick Jann from a script by Abigail Miller, Alma & the Wolf also stars Jeremie Harris, Lukas Jann, Beth Malone, Kevin Allison, Alexandra Doke, and Mather Zickel. The film is produced by Jann alongside David Codron and Eric Binns, and marks Ethan Embry’s first horror film since 2015’s The Devil’s Candy, directed by Sean Byrne, whose shark-obsessed serial killer film Dangerous Animals hits theaters this Friday.
